We examine Uganda’s democratic elections and the challenges facing Kampala’s service delivery. From the ongoing sit-down strike by traders to concerns over urban development, we ask: what can leaders do, and what should residents demand from those contesting leadership positions?We speak with Pollar Awich (NRM, Director of External Affairs), Nana Mwafrika (FDC candidate, Kampala Woman MP), and Ronald Balimwezo (NUP Lord Mayor candidate).
